1. Game Winner

Derby Points/Rank: 45 – 8th

Race Record: (5) 4-1-0

Earnings: $1,646,000

Breeding: Candy Ride – Indyan Giving

Owner: Gary and Mary West

Trainer: Bob Baffert

Last Race: Rebel Stakes (G2) at Oaklawn Park, Finished 2nd

Racing Dudes Fantasy League Owner: Paul “Free Beers” Withrow

Analysis: It was good to see the Breeders’ Cup Juvenile (G1) winner back in action in the Rebel Stakes (G2) at Oaklawn Park. Even though he lost, he was still valiant in defeat, finishing second by a nose to Omaha Beach. At the top of the stretch, it looked as though Omaha Beach would easily win; however, Game Winner dug down deep to make it extremely close. He will move forward off of this effort, which should make him tough to beat moving forward.

2. Omaha Beach

Derby Points/Rank: 37.5 – 10th

Race Record: (6) 2-3-1

Earnings: $521,800

Breeding: War Front – Charming

Owner: Fox Hill Farms, INC.

Trainer: Richard Mandella

Last Race: Rebel Stakes (G2) at Oaklawn Park, Finished 1st

Racing Dudes Fantasy League Owner: Jon White/Ryan Stillman

Analysis: This horse ran huge in the Rebel Stakes (G2), proving to be a high class animal that we must take serious moving forward. Coming into the race, it was reasonable to question his ability; however, there is no reason to question it now. His pedigree should be a benefit to him moving forward, and his running style will suit the Kentucky Derby very well.

3. Long Range Toddy

Derby Points/Rank: 53.5 – 4th

Race Record: (7) 4-1-1

Earnings: $851,125

Breeding: Take Charge Indy – Pleasant Song

Owner: Willis Horton Racing LLC

Trainer: Steve Asmussen

Last Race: Rebel Stakes (G2) at Oaklawn Park, Finished 1st

Racing Dudes Fantasy League Owner: Aaron Halterman

Analysis: He became a serious contender in the Rebel Stakes (G2) at Oaklawn Park, where he ran down our previous #1 ranked horse to win the race by a nose in the final stages. He has progressively gotten better with each start, while possessing a pedigree that should only see him get better as the distances get longer. This is now a serious player heading into the last round of prep races.

7. Hidden Scroll

Derby Points/Rank: 5 – 38th

Race Record: (2) 1-0-0

Earnings: $50,600

Breeding: Hard Spun – Sheba Queen

Owner: Juddmonte Farms, INC.

Trainer: Bill Mott

Last Race: Fountain of Youth Stakes (G2) at Gulfstream Park, Finished 4th

Racing Dudes Fantasy League Owner: Jon White/Ryan Stillman

Analysis: There is no question in my mind that Hidden Scroll was the best horse in the Fountain of Youth Stakes (G2). However, if he does not learn to rate his early speed, he will have a tough time winning major stakes races. On the other hand, if he can learn to sit off horses, he is a prime Kentucky Derby candidate. His start this weekend in the Florida Derby (G1) will make or break him.

10. Anothertwistafate

Derby Points/Rank: 30 – 12th

Race Record: (5) 3-1-0

Earnings: $263,505

Breeding: Scat Daddy – Imperfection

Owner: Peter Redekop B. C., Ltd.

Trainer: Blaine D. Wright

Last Race: Sunland Derby (G3) at Sunland Park, Finished 2nd

Racing Dudes Fantasy League Owner: Paul “Free Beers” Withrow

Analysis: There is no doubt he looked like the best horse in the Sunland Derby (G3) even though he came up a neck short. With a better trip he would have gotten there; however, the most important factor for him was proving he could run on the dirt. That mission was accomplished, which makes him a very interesting prospect heading into the first Saturday in May.
